    That's true, that's what the lawsuit was about, Fagen wanting the contract they'd made to be honored by Beckers estate.

    Really i think Walter had been tired of the whole thing since Gaucho and that he had to be coaxed into Two Against Nature/Everything Must Go - after his initial recovery from addiction he mellowed out and Donald seems to have had to bug him to get him to do things (yes they worked on each others solo stuff but that was more laid back than SD sessions) - I don't have a link handy but I read an interview w DF where he said at one point Becker just quit calling him back - in still another Becker said he just didn't have the attention span anymore for the perfectionism that was Steely Dan (these interviews were post TAN/EMG btw)
